SUMMARY: Markit! Forestry Management LLC is looking for Non-certified Arborists to help in the identification, assessment, and inventory of vegetation within and adjacent to electrical utility rights of way. You will be working with various utility companies on behalf of Markit! to assess potential vegetation conflicts and determine appropriate mitigation to ensure compliance with all applicable vegetation clearance laws and regulations, and will play a major role in helping positively impact change in how these lands and forests are maintained over time. 

What You'll be Doing:

  • Meet project goals as established by Markit!’s project manager.
  • Inspect and inventory the utility rights of way, easements, and/or adjacent lands for potential or existing vegetation conflicts. 
  • Identify targeted vegetation and necessary mitigation actions to prevent/address conflict with utility infrastructure utilizing a GIS on an iOS or android device.  
  • Coordinate with Markit! employees and project managers as it relates to inventory results, project planning, and workflow.  
  • Represent Markit! in a professional manner in all interactions incidental to this role.
